Handover: Brackenmoor incremental rebuilds. Quick version: the static site rebuilds only pages whose content hash changed. Don't trigger full rebuilds during business hours — it hammers the asset cache. The watcher process runs on the build box and must stay pinned to one instance or you get duplicate deploys. Logs rotate nightly; check them before blaming the CDN. Everything else is in the wiki. The settings the watcher currently runs with are listed directly below.

settings of tagef-bawif:
DRUIX_HOST=druix.zemvarlabs.internal
DRUIX_PORT=8000

Handover for the security review of Spanview, our diff viewer for large files. Main points: chunked rendering caps memory at 512 MB, and untrusted diffs are sandboxed in the Quillbank worker pool. Known gap: the legacy binary-diff path skips content sanitization — flagged in the audit notes. To inspect the sealed audit archive you will need the recovery passphrase, stated on the next line.

unlock words, yawig-kagef: gordor-holvan-ulaael-pramir-ulaiel-tamdor

## 2.8.0 — Changed defaults

Cron jobs in Larkspool are gone. All scheduled tasks now run through the Fennwick workflow engine. Default retry count dropped from 5 to 3; default timeout is now 90s. If customers report missed schedules, check Fennwick's run history first, not crontab. Old cron entries are disabled, not deleted, until 3.0. Escalate anything odd to the platform channel. The new defaults for the scheduler service are as follows.

deployment values, kajep-kageg:
[praix]
host = praix.paliqcorp.corp
user = praix_svc
database = praix_prod